Cross country is literally riding a bicycle across the countryside. It is the least extreme and easiest form of mountain biking to get into. However, when it comes to racing it then involves cycling laps around a short distance off-road course in a set time.

The idea is simple, mounds of dirt are shaped into take-offs that sends the rider into the air, the rider comes in to land on a similar mound of dirt that is shaped into a transition, or landing. Whilst airborne the rider will attempt tricks.

This is a popular form of mountain biking. It entails hurtling down extremely steep elevated slopes in timed runs whilst also adding some flair to the riding. Riders require a fully faced helmet and body armour with the bike having great amounts of travel on the suspension.

A long distance mountain bike event which usually attracts many riders to endure a ride of about 100km either in a point to point, one large loop or many medium sized looped circuits. Some endurance events are held through the night or over an entire 24 hour period.

A form of downhill cycling where riders compete on a track (up to four abreast), similar to that of a BMX course. Riders require a tough bike with an amount of suspension at the front and possibly on the rear (depends on the rider's taste) whilst also wearing some form of protective armour.

A fairly new term for riding. It requires a bicycle with a large amount of suspension (front and rear), similar to the proportion of a downhill bike. Riders go anywhere and do any form of riding in a free unforgiving style in any environment.

For lovers of one gear only. It's the form of going back to where we all started out on a bike, keeping it all very simple. The Singlespeed cult is now become a fashion and is the must have, must do genre of mountain biking.

Street and park riding are both about taking it to the city and being the biggest, baddest kid in the urban playground. Use ledges, walls, rails and stairsets to show everyone who’s boss or tear up some bowls and whip it out big on the hips in the skate park.

Trials is probably the most specialised form of mountain biking. It requires near perfect balance and a series of techniques that are rarely, if ever seen in the other riding disciplines.
